BitMart delivery time for the current week’s contract
Understanding the delivery time for BitMart's current week's contract is crucial for futures traders, enabling them to effectively manage positions, mitigate risks, and optimize their trading strategies based on market conditions and volatility.

BitMart, a renowned cryptocurrency exchange, enables traders to engage in futures trading through its diverse offering of contracts. Among these contracts, the current week's contract holds significance as it provides traders with the opportunity to speculate on the price movements of underlying cryptocurrencies within a defined time frame. Understanding the delivery time for this contract is crucial for traders seeking to effectively manage their positions and avoid potential risks.
Key Considerations:- Contract Duration: The current week's contract on BitMart typically has a duration of one week, commencing on Monday at 08:00 UTC and expiring the following Monday at 08:00 UTC. This time frame aligns with the global financial markets, facilitating easy coordination for traders worldwide.
- Delivery Time: The delivery time for the current week's contract occurs precisely at the moment of contract expiration, which is Monday at 08:00 UTC. At this predetermined time, the contract settles, and the underlying cryptocurrency is delivered to the trader's現貨wallet.
- Settlement Price: The settlement price for the current week's contract is determined based on the Mark Price at the time of delivery. The Mark Price represents a fair and unbiased price derived from various market data sources, ensuring transparency and minimizing the impact of potential market manipulation.
Traders must carefully consider the delivery time when engaging in futures trading on BitMart. Here's why:
- Position Closure: If a trader holds a position in the current week's contract, it is imperative to close or adjust the position before the delivery time to avoid automatic settlement. Failure to do so may result in the delivery of the underlying cryptocurrency, which may not align with the trader's intended strategy.
- Risk Management: The delivery time serves as a critical reference point for risk management. Traders can adjust their positions or employ hedging strategies to minimize potential losses if the market moves against their predictions before the contract's expiration.
- Trading Strategy: The delivery time influences trading strategies. Scalpers and intraday traders may prefer to close their positions well before delivery to avoid exposure to overnight risks, while swing traders may hold positions until closer to the delivery time to capitalize on potential price movements.
- Market Volatility: Delivery time becomes particularly significant during periods of high market volatility. Rapid price fluctuations can impact the Mark Price and, consequently, the settlement price, potentially affecting traders' profitability.
- Contract Specifications: Each current week's contract on BitMart may have unique specifications, including the underlying cryptocurrency, contract size, and margin requirements. Traders should thoroughly review these details before entering into any positions.
- Trading Fees: BitMart charges trading fees for futures contracts, which may vary based on the contract type and the trader's trading volume. Familiarizing oneself with the fee structure is crucial for optimizing profitability.
- Monitor Market Conditions: Traders should closely monitor market conditions leading up to the delivery time. This involves tracking price movements, analyzing market sentiment, and staying informed about relevant news and events.
- Adjust Trading Positions: If necessary, traders should adjust their trading positions before the delivery time to align with their risk tolerance and profit targets. This may involve reducing the position size, adjusting stop-loss orders, or employing hedging strategies.
- Consider Hedging: Hedging can be a valuable risk management tool in the lead-up to delivery time. Traders can use options or other derivative instruments to mitigate potential losses if the market moves against their predictions.
- Review Contract Specifications: Traders should ensure they fully understand the contract specifications, including the underlying cryptocurrency, contract size, and delivery time. This information is readily available on the BitMart platform.
